Brief History of Brislington Brislington is known to have been inhabited in Roman times due to the fact that the remains of a Roman villa dating from around advertisement 270-300 were discovered when Winchester Roadway was being constructed in1899. The villa was most likely the centre of a big estate and is thought to have actually been damaged by fire concerning AD 367, probably after a raid by Irish pirates.Originally it was offered by the Augustinian canons from Keynsham Abbey which was founded in about 1166. The present church days from 1420 and was constructed by the fifth Baron Thomas la Warr. The family (later on the de la Warrs) were the lords of the manor from the late 12th Century to the late 16th Century; they were to give their name to the state of Delaware in the U.S.A..

Brislington had 2 mansion residences. The middle ages moated and fortified estate home of the de la Warrs stood in West Community Lane.
It was converted right into flats in 2001. The second, the Arno's Team of buildings, (including 'The Black Castle') was built by William Reeve, an abundant eccentric Quaker copper smelter. In 1850 your house became a Roman Catholic convent and girl's prison college, remaining so until 1948. It ended up being a resort in 1960.
